Understanding Hydraulic Hose Crimpers – Types, Features, and Applications
Hydraulic tube crimpers are critical machines for producing secure fittings on hydraulic tubes. These devices utilize a pressing process to shape a ferrule around the line and a fitting, forming a leak-proof {connection|joint|assembly|. There are multiple sorts of hydraulic crimpers on the market, each built for particular uses. Manual crimpers offer portability and are suitable for minor tasks, while hydraulic crimpers provide increased power and are preferred for larger manufacturing. Automatic crimpers further improve efficiency and consistency in the pressing process. Key attributes to consider include swaging capacity, line dimension limit, and the functionality to process varying sleeve calibers. Common purposes encompass hydraulic power systems in industries such as agribusiness, construction, mining, and manufacturing.
- Manual Crimpers: Offer ease of use for smaller projects.
- Hydraulic Crimpers: Provide greater force for high-volume production.
- Automatic Crimpers: Increase productivity and consistency.

Hydraulic Hose Crimper Maintenance: Prolonging Equipment Service Life
Regular servicing of your hose crimping machine is critically important for maximizing its durability . Neglecting routine checks can prematurely lead to expensive breakdowns and a reduced operational period . Simple tasks like cleaning debris from the tooling , oiling moving mechanisms, and inspecting the power unit for drips can noticeably improve the equipment's useful existence . Always refer to the equipment's documentation for specific recommendations and timeline your proactive attention accordingly.
